Synthesis and characterization of AZO-Benzothiazole compounds and study the effect of lateral substituents on their liquid crystalline properties supported by the theoretical results
International Journal of Chemical Research and Development · 2021 · Vol. 3(1) · pp. 06–10
Abstract
Compounds EB-4Cl and EB- 3,4Cl were prepared and diagnosed by spectral methods FTIR, NMR and Mass. They also studied by polarized microscope and did not diagnose any liquid crystalline phases in the compounds. The total dipole moment of the molecules and the length and width of the molecules as well as the length of the bonds were theoretically calculated.
